## PR: Plug descriptor leaks in Fernhollow ingest workers

Traced the leak to retry paths in the Fernhollow ingest pool: sockets opened for health probes were never closed on timeout. This PR wraps probe handles in scoped guards and adds a watchdog that logs descriptor counts per worker. To keep the watchdog cheap, its sampling behavior is governed by the constants below.

tuning constants:
QUOTAS = {
    "druwyn": 5,
    "holix": 5,
    "zorath": 5,
    "holwyn": 10,
}

Ticket #4182 — GridWeave crossword generator failing to connect to the puzzle store. New folks: the generator pulls clue banks from the Lexicon database every build, and since Tuesday about 30% of attempts time out. Restarting the worker doesn't help. To reproduce locally, point the generator at the staging database using the connection string below.

primary connection of yagep-kahip = redis://giliel_svc:zYiKsLL2PLpfPL@db-348f.xolmarsys.corp:5432/fenwyn

Gridwright, our crossword generator, pulls word lists from the Lexhaven dictionary service and caches puzzles locally. All configuration lives in `.env.gridwright` at the repo root; copy the example file and adjust as needed. `GRID_SIZE_DEFAULT` controls the default puzzle dimensions, `LEXHAVEN_URL` points at the dictionary endpoint, and `CACHE_DIR` sets the local puzzle cache path. The Lexhaven service rejects unauthenticated requests, so right after the `LEXHAVEN_URL` entry, add the line containing the dictionary API credential.

env line for yahip-tafog: RELAY_SECRET3=4ca